About Towers Watson

Go beyond. At Towers Watson, we are more than individuals. We are a community focused on helping our colleagues and clients thrive and succeed.

Towers Watson is a leading global professional services company that helps organisations improve performance through effective people, financial and risk management. With 14,000 associates around the world, we offer solutions in the areas of benefits, talent management, rewards, and risk and capital management.

The Business

The investment consulting industry has evolved rapidly over recent years. The increasing complexity of investment decision-making means our clients need specialist services and specialist advice. We have built our business on deep areas of specialist expertise and our service is distinguished by a proactive, research-led approach. As a leading investment consultancy, we help organisations manage investment complexity, establish risk tolerance and improve governance.

The Role

You will work as part of a team on a wide variety of complex projects. You will serve as a key resource for the consultant in charge of each of your engagements by performing many intricate aspects of the client work. As you grow and gain more expertise, you will become a key contact for the client. You will work alongside some of the industry’s top consultants on client projects including many household names while you progress towards qualifying as an actuary or obtaining the CFA qualification.

The Requirements

As a minimum when applying you should meet our entry criteria:

  • 2:1 Degree in a numerate discipline and 300 UCAS points (across 3 'A' levels or equivalent), OR
  • 2:1 Degree in any discipline and 300 UCAS points (across 3 'A' levels or equivalent) including Maths at grade A or B
